  1. Hi all! Please excuse me, but I wanted to ask you for a word of wisdom on a problem that I have been having. I am an international applicant who is to complete an MA from Asia as of the summer of 2020. For the Fall 2020, I have applied for political science (international relations) doctoral programs in the U.S., yet have received four MA offers and 0 for the doctoral program. My four offers include: Boston College (Political Science) MA, which has a faculty that experts in the research that I am interested in. University of Chicago (Committee of International Relations) MA, which I have heard is a great stepping stone to prepare for a doctoral program. For the program, I have been offered scholarship (although not much). American University (SIS) MA, which is located in Washington D.C. and has a decent ranking in IR. For the program, I have been offered scholarship (although not much). New York University (International Relations) MA, which is costly yet believe to be a great program. Or maybe I should try to find something else as I didn't get into any doctoral programs? While I am very intrigued to pursue a doctoral program in the U.S., as I will have one MA by this summer, I wanted to ask if you could give me some suggestions on what to do? Thank you.
